Thor 雷神 & Jason Lengstorf If you’re not sure which ones you need, start with posts, pages, and navigation menu items — you can always adjust these settings later on. Netlify comes with some handy, built-in features to process form submissions without having to write any server-side code. Netlify listens for any changes from WordPress and new content is fetched using the WordPress APIs. One important thing to note is that we also need to load the site’s URL from the generalSettings query because WordPress makes links absolute by default. Visit the Netlify Community for discussion about this blog post. [Video] Did you know that you can use Netlify's split testing (beta) feature to give your users the ability to opt-in to private betas and version of your site. in Run WordPress as a headless CMS with Netlify building your site and delivering it to end users. By WordPress menus allow content editors to control the navigation settings on the site. Migration from Wordpress to Static Site Using Hugo and Netlify - A Step-by-Step Tutorial. A short tutorial on the static site generator Metalsmith and how to host it on Netlify (incl. By October 25, 2017. To allow site visitors to browse blog posts, we need to create a page that lists post previews. This looks pretty okay considering we didn’t write any custom styles. To apply our styles, we need to import the stylesheet in our Layout component: After saving this change, our page at http://localhost:8000 will start looking a little more stylish. NOTE: There are lots of additional options for starting a new Gatsby site with WordPress that come with batteries included. A guide to building and hosting a site created with Cactus on Netlify. Guides & Tutorials in This plugin builds your static website using Netlify webhooks to trigger the deploy … Once we have a layout component, we need to import it in our page template and wrap it around the output: Once we’ve saved these changes, we can head to http://localhost:8000 to see the header at the top of the page. gregraven May 1, 2020, 2:35pm #2. Both applications use PersistentVolumes and PersistentVolumeClaims to store data. • A PersistentVolume (PV) is a piece of storage in the cluster that has been manually provisioned by an administrator, or dynamically provisioned by Kubernetes using a StorageClass. A step-by-step guide on how to host a website built with static site generator Hexo. Once the site has started, visit http://localhost:8000. Aaron Autrand By The third screen asks for … Install the plugin with the following command: After installing the plugin, we need to load it by modifying gatsby-config.js: Save this, then start the Gatsby development server by running: Once the site finishes starting up, open http://localhost:8000/___graphql in your browser to see Gatsby’s version of GraphiQL. Guides & Tutorials In WordPress, content can be split up into multiple content types. • • To do this, update src/components/layout.js with the following code: Save and check out the site to see that the settings are being loaded. in First, visit https://app.netlify.com/start in your browser. A step-by-step guide to securing your site with a custom SSL certificate. This brings up the GraphiQL interface inside our WordPress dashboard. Brian Rinaldi Get Lingo: A handy glossary to demystify WordPress terms. Check out this tutorial to learn how. Creating a Layout component requires a standard React component that wraps whatever content is passed to it (as the children prop) with markup to give the page semantic structure. May 25, 2016, Hosting a Static eCommerce Site built with Flatmarket on Netlify, By Gatsby uses source plugins to load data. Make the following changes to put this in place: Stop the server and restart it, then visit one of your post URLs, such as http://localhost:8000/blog/wordpress-jamstack. We’ll use the WordPress dashboard for rich content editing, while migrating the front-end architecture to the JAMstack to benefit from better security, performance, and reliability. Guides & Tutorials Aaron Autrand • • Gatsby Tutorials is a community-updated list of video, audio and written tutorials to help you learn GatsbyJS. the author’s name, their bio, and a list of their articles, like WordPress does? Guides & Tutorials September 26, 2017. Guides & Tutorials Guides & Tutorials We’re intentionally building this site from scratch to make sure we understand how Gatsby and WordPress work together under the hood. Once you’ve created the hook, copy the URL and paste it into the WordPress Deployment settings … Guides & Tutorials • Guides & Tutorials • A step-by-step guide on how to host a site built with Exposé - A simple static site generator for photoessays written in Bash. To fill this section out, we need to create a Build Hook in our Netlify settings. You can play around with the live version at tasty.netlify.com. in Maxime Castres By RESTful APIs are great, adding them is simple too! If you want to test this out, make a change in WordPress, then restart the Gatsby development server to see the changes. By Mathias Biilmann in Guides & Tutorials • January 17, 2018 Coding Modern Websites with the JAMstack: Part 3 In this tutorial, we will explore how to add user form handling. If you’re working on one of the roughly 1 in 3 websites powered by WordPress and wish you could migrate your development workflow to the Jamstack, I have good news! in To make our Gatsby site look more like a real website, we need to add a layout — a shared header in this case — and styles. Fortunately, the process for creating pages from WordPress posts is very similar to the process for creating WordPress pages. Alright! And what’s even more exciting is that your content creators don’t need to change their current workflow! Companies at every size need to make money to survive. • October 28, 2015. Phil Hawksworth Enjoying this article? • Brian Douglas Shawn Erquhart July 20, 2017, GraphQL is a query language for APIs and a runtime for fulfilling those queries with your existing data. To do this, we’re going to create a Gatsby page at src/pages/blog.js, query for post data, and map over the results to create a list of previews: Save this file, then head to http://localhost:8000/blog to see the previews. March 23, 2020. • In this post, we’ll walk through migrating a WordPress site to Gatsby, a popular Jamstack framework powered by React and GraphQL. Guides & Tutorials December 8, 2015. Gatsby Head to the Netlify dashboard, then click Settings. November 24, 2015. in Guides & Tutorials I will walk through setting up GraphQL in a React project that saves notes on interesting open source projects using Graphcool as a GraphQL backend as a service and Apollo as a …, By Use Stripe Checkout & Netlify Functions to add e-commerce in minutes. By To differentiate posts from pages, each post will have its URL prefixed with blog/. Learn how to build a self-hosted, open-source blog. • So I’m new to Jamstack and Netlify and Gatsby, but I have been building Wordpress sites for over 10 years. Guides & Tutorials to make sure you don't miss anything. Finally, check boxes for the types of updates that should trigger a rebuild on Netlify. Divya Sasidharan in For example, if we want to load our site’s pages, we can run this query: Great! • • In this tutorial, we will explore how to add user form handling. Guides & Tutorials August 17, 2017. NOTE: The lessons from the egghead course are also embedded in this tutorial so it’s easy to watch and reference the code. Click the new “GraphiQL” menu option at the left-hand side. A step-by-step guide on how to host a website made with static site generator Hugo. Netlify prerenders your entire site using any tools and frameworks you configure. April 28, 2016. To install the plugins, log into the server where your site is hosted and clone the plugins into the wp-content/plugins directory: This will add the latest files to your site’s plugins directory without including unnecessary Git metadata. Guides & Tutorials A step-by-step guide on how to host a website built with static site generator Jekyll 4.0. Guides & Tutorials in Instantly build and deploy your sites to our global network from Git. By New! Guides & Tutorials The site we built in this tutorial is live at https://egghead-wordpress-jamstack.netlify.com. Guides & Tutorials This tutorial will help you get up and running with Storybook 3 and Preact. Subscribe to our newsletter to make sure you don’t miss anything. • The heart of a Jamstack-friendly WordPress site is pulling WordPress data from an API instead of using the built-in template system. Jason Lengstorf Once the plugins are installed, we need to activate them. Next, go to the Settings page of your Netlify dashboard and scroll down to the “Status badges” section. Guides & Tutorials By By October 22, 2015. • October 6, 2017. April 2, 2020. Explore how to build a client-side application using modern tooling for a restaurant serving a modern cuisine. Then choose Github, and authorize Netlify to access your Github account. Subscribe to our newsletter for more great Jamstack content. • We’ve now got a functioning GraphQL API for WordPress that we can use to power our Jamstack frontend! Easily deploy static sites to Netlify using WordPress as backend. Learn how in this tutorial on creating a custom Strapi back-end. in By The tutorial doesn’t cover that. Using this value, we can loop through the menu links and remove the URL to make sure we have relative links. Guides & Tutorials WordPress returns markup and HTML-encoded entities, so we need to use dangerouslySetInnerHTML to make sure our content displays properly. Netlify Dev + Serverless Functions + MailChimp Subscribe Form Tutorial Create a working serverless function hosted on Netlify, automatically built and deployed every time you push to git, that you can use on your static site to add subscriber emails directly to MailChimp Aaron Autrand May 16, 2017. September 19, 2017. Eli Williamson Jason Lengstorf Help & Tutorials; Sign in; Sign up; Google Data Studio, WordPress, Netlify Integrations. Guides & Tutorials Check out the enterprise technology partner directory to do more with the Jamstack. April 11, 2016. in To create pages, create a new file in the root directory (next to gatsby-config.js) called gatsby-node.js. We should see both WP GraphQL and WP GraphiQL as installed, but not activated. Aaron Autrand A quick rundown on integrating Netlify forms into a Vue application. January 17, 2018. in September 7, 2018. By By Aaron Autrand Inside, let’s add a createPages API call: After saving this file, we can stop the server (press control + C), then run npm run develop again. Guides & Tutorials • A step-by-step guide on how to host a website built with static site generator Docpad. A step-by-step guide on how to host a website built with static site generator Wintersmith. March 8, 2016, A short tutorial on how to set up Punch in continuous deployment on Netlify, with assets on GitHub, By Laurie Voss It seems to be a tailored solution for used a WordPress on the back end to generate some kind of JAMStack site. At this point, our WordPress site has been fully migrated to the Jamstack: we’re loading pages, posts, settings, and menus into a fully functional Gatsby site. Guides & Tutorials April 28, 2020. Deploy a Strapi and React Blog on Netlify, Manage Subscriptions and Protect Content With Stripe, Use a Custom Strapi Back-End to Build a Jamstack App, Create a Custom Back-End for Jamstack Apps with Strapi, Learn to Add Apple Pay and Google Pay to React Websites, Add a Donation Button & Start Accepting Money On Jamstack Sites, Automate Order Fulfillment w/Stripe Webhooks & Netlify Functions, Learn How to Accept Money on Jamstack Sites in 38 Minutes, A Step-by-Step Guide: Jekyll 4.0 on Netlify, How to Integrate Netlify Forms in a Vue App, JAMstack architecture on Netlify: How Identity and Functions work together, Create your own URL shortener with Netlify’s Forms and Functions, How to use split tests to give users access to private features, Coding Modern Websites with the JAMstack: Part 3, Coding Modern Websites with the JAMstack: Part 2, Coding Modern Websites with the JAMstack, Part 1, How to Build a Serverless, SEO-friendly React blog, Form Handling with the JAMstack and Netlify, A Complete CMS with No Server and 18 Lines of Code, How to Integrate Netlify’s Form Handling in a React App, Using GraphQL to manage open source repositories, New to JAMstack? By Netlify in Case Studies • July 8, 2020 Migrate Your WordPress Site to the Jamstack Keep the benefits of WordPress … Adding styles helps our site look a bit more polished. And that’s it! News & Announcements March 4, 2016. Aaron Autrand After a gap of almost three years, I recently decided to relaunch my six year old self-hosted wordpress blog TechnoDuet. • Guides & Tutorials Choose fields in the explorer at the left-hand side to build out a query. A short guide to help you set up Gatsby on Netlify with continuous deployment. Whether you’re a non-profit or an indie creator, get started with Stripe in minutes! WordPress By WP GraphQL makes these settings available to our Gatsby site, so we can take advantage of this workflow to enable non-developers to update settings for our Gatsby site as well. Get started for free. To do that, we need to install a plugin called JAMstack Deployments on our WordPress site. A step-by-step guide on how to host Ember on Netlify. In this example we’ll use Gatsby, an open source, React-based framework that specializes in pulling data from third-party sources. January 11, 2016. A WordPress blog requires a server running the WordPress software, and that software does all the heavy lifting. Aaron Autrand Guides & Tutorials If you check the Deploys page of your Netlify dashboard, we’ll see that the site is rebuilding! Shifter is a static site generator and hosting platform for WordPress. in Check out the enterprise technology partner directory to do more with the Jamstack. Then we can run ntl init to connect our site’s repo to Netlify, which means any time we push code changes the site will redeploy. in Learn how to accept money on Jamstack sites in this tutorial (with videos)! Eli Williamson In Gatsby, writing a query to load WordPress data is almost exactly the same as the one we used in WP GraphiQL, except Gatsby wraps all WordPress queries in wpgraphql — the fieldName we set in our config — to avoid naming collisions with other data sources. Wordpress site your portfolio or web coding project published on Netlify pretty okay considering we ’... A bit more polished blog posts, we need to make the following:. Make the following edits: now we ’ re getting pretty close!! You want to test this out, we can loop through the WordPress... Jamstack is a perfect option for loading our WordPress data, we wordpress netlify tutorial use WordPress. Brian Douglas in Guides & Tutorials • October 6, 2017 year old self-hosted blog. 10, 2016, Microservices are great, adding them is simple too data loaded in Gatsby an! To help you get up and running forms into a Vue application by Morente. Left-Hand side load post data and create Gatsby pages load the correct menu your! A new Gatsby site, we need to make a website built with static site using Hugo Netlify... Guide, you ’ re a non-profit or an indie creator, get started with in... A simple static site generator Gitbook or ask a question in the at. Our newly deployed site that specializes in pulling data from an API instead of using the admin! Server to see the changes see our newly deployed site third-party sources let ’ s,... Covered all the services you need & Jason Lengstorf & Thor 雷神 in Guides & •! React-Based framework that specializes in pulling data from third-party sources to test this out, make a built... Up Netlify CMS and WordPress work together under the hood our newsletter to make a change WordPress... In Bash custom SSL certificate handling with notifications and Zapier integration within Netlify news & •! Pages from WordPress ’ s pull the site has started, visit:. Data using the Netlify Community Netlify news 7, 2018 be split up into multiple content.! Wordpress are both open source, React-based framework that specializes in pulling data an. Http: //localhost:8000 Netlify CLI, you ’ ll see that the site finishes building which... A query most approachable options for starting a new Jamstack site that has access to newsletter... Fully live and on the Netlify Community of how a single page CMS. The services you need this section out, make a website using Jamstack practices can loop the... A template component in Gatsby can likely use whatever flavor of CSS you prefer get Lingo a. Open-Source blog rebuild on Netlify more great Jamstack content to static site Docpad. Heroku & auto-deploy changes to your Netlify site Jamstack frontend with Exposé - a step-by-step guide on how build. Database using Minikube our WordPress site to Gatsby on egghead the template component Gatsby... Site ’ s Payment Request API to quickly accept payments on your React sites the changes for written. Built with static site generator Nanoc and how to manage content using a headless CMS with basic user.... Cdn, Continuous deployment site finishes building, which allows us to use any API!, 2:35pm # 2 re a non-profit or an indie creator, started. New Jamstack site that will display it called Jamstack Deployments on our WordPress admin dashboard then. Are lots of additional options for starting a new Gatsby site, we need to install a wordpress netlify tutorial! Gordon on learn with Jason a data source in Gatsby a gap of almost three years, I recently to... On Netlify is it possible to move your Jekyll site from scratch to make sure you do n't anything! Handling service in money on your React app popular content management system the! Post is an expanded version of a project I built with static generator. Roger Jin in Guides & Tutorials • January 17, 2017, 2017 ’ s pull site! November 15, 2016 September 7, 2018 others could see what you ’ re not available the. Started, visit HTTPS: //egghead-wordpress-jamstack.netlify.com trigger a rebuild on Netlify Laurie Voss in news & •! Hook in our Netlify settings badges ” section to control the navigation settings on static. Write any server-side code ( incl we understand how Gatsby and WordPress together. Deployments settings fields the changes how this can work Sign in and click “ new! Or single-page app on Netlify for free of it as the quick-start tutorial. This example we ’ ll use Gatsby, but this is a static site generator Jekyll 4.0 developer-focused, required! Deploy the site • October 20, 2016, this is your first time using the built-in template.... Manage user subscriptions and paywall content in this tutorial will help you get up and with... A step-by-step guide on how to get up and running with Storybook 3 and Preact and transaction email from.. And remove the URL to make the following edits: now we ’ re getting pretty close here August. The Gatsby development server to see the changes Jamstack e-commerce site for fulfillment using Stripe webhooks, Functions! Out, make a change in WordPress, then click settings only take a minute or so the... Pulling data from an API instead of using the Netlify platform notifications and integration... Netlify wordpress netlify tutorial your entire site using any tools and frameworks you configure open-source blog the Deployments. To be a tailored solution for used a WordPress site to Gatsby by pressing the button... Change their current workflow change in WordPress, content can be split up into multiple content types in! Money on Jamstack sites in this guide, you ’ re seeing access our. Netlify provides a great way to keep your codebase understandable portfolio or web project... Previews, rollbacks, and share your knowledge choose the new Deployments section wordpress netlify tutorial websites today! “ Status badges ” section Jekyll site from scratch to make sure have! Required a lot of rote code content types a functional static site generator Hexo and written Tutorials to you! Can be split up into multiple content types February 24, 2015 WordPress data loaded in Gatsby I with... Can update src/components/layout.js to load our site ’ s general settings to show how this work. June 23, 2020 using a headless CMS with basic user authentication ( deployment! Correct menu a quick rundown on integrating Netlify forms into a functional static site generator Nanoc and to! Blog post third screen asks for … this tutorial is live at HTTPS: //app.netlify.com/start your! Wordpress posts is very similar to the Jamstack May 21, 2016 building which! Glossary to demystify WordPress terms load post data and create Gatsby pages host a website built with Exposé a. Title from WordPress ’ s possible to move your WordPress site to Gatsby Announcements. From an API instead of using the basics of HTML, CSS and. A server running the WordPress admin dashboard, then restart the Gatsby development to. Others could see what you ’ re going to query for individual page using... Click settings There are lots of additional options for accessing WordPress data, we accomplish. Community-Updated list of video, audio and written Tutorials to help you set up, we need to the! The third screen asks for … this tutorial will help you set Gatsby! — we ’ ll see our WordPress admin dashboard, we need to have the menu we to! A standalone tool and a hands-on explanation of how a single page app CMS works Mathias. Needs extra power, create a new Jamstack site, an open source, React-based framework that in! Jamstack & Netlify news start, we need to make sure we how! Guide on how to host a WordPress site to Gatsby WordPress pages a explanation! To turn that blog into a Vue application make sure we understand how and. For discussion about this blog post custom styles... Netlify can pull from GitHub pages to in... Built-In template system to see the changes steps required to migrate WordPress sites for 10... Guide, you ’ ll use Gatsby, an open source, React-based framework that in! & Announcements • March 10, 2016 have content, we need to install from. With some handy, built-in features to process form submissions without having to some... Shawn Erquhart in Guides & Tutorials • July 24, 2015 never knew you needed for “ Jamstack ” see! Exciting is that your content creators don ’ t need to create a build Hook in Netlify... Is simple too Sasidharan in Guides & Tutorials • July 8, 2015, an open,. Or an indie creator, get started with Stripe in minutes ID, we can site started! Menu links and remove the URL to make sure we understand how Gatsby and WordPress are both open source React-based... Editors to control the navigation settings on the Netlify dashboard, we need install!, Zac and I migrated a WordPress site and a hands-on explanation of how a single app... You how to migrate a WordPress blog TechnoDuet for free accessing WordPress data, we can duplicate and. Version at tasty.netlify.com save these settings, then restart the Gatsby development server to see the changes your browser your. Seems to be a tailored solution for used a WordPress blog TechnoDuet fetched using the built-in template system Netlify form. Have a Gatsby site, we can update src/components/layout.js to load the correct menu ready to actually it. In Guides & Tutorials • November 24, 2016 a standard React component remove the to! Minute or so, the process for creating static wordpress netlify tutorial, and all the heavy lifting on your React..